Runbook: GridSmith crossword generator — dictionary refresh. When the nightly puzzle build stalls, first confirm the wordlist sync job completed; GridSmith will not emit grids against a stale dictionary. Restart the builder with `gridsmith rebuild --themed` and watch for clue-bank checksum warnings. The builder reads its config from `/etc/gridsmith/.env`, which must include the clue-bank API credential before any rebuild. Add the following line to that file to set it:

sealed setting: LEDGER_TOKEN5=bcca1

Ticket: Markdown pipeline choking on auth, not on markdown

Heads up, future maintainers: if Quillpress renders start 500ing across the board, check creds before blaming the parser. That's what happened here — the token the pipeline uses to fetch embeds from the Snipvault service quietly expired, and every doc with an embed block failed. Rotation is now on the calendar so this shouldn't sneak up again. The freshly issued key for Snipvault is below.

API key for yahig-tadup: kto7_ubizbYm

## Formula sandbox tuning

User-supplied formulas in Gridmoor execute inside a restricted interpreter with hard ceilings on time, memory, and call depth. Reviewers should confirm any change to these ceilings is justified in the PR description, since raising them widens the abuse surface. Defaults were chosen from production traces. The current limits are as follows.

limits module of tafog-fawip:
WEIGHTS = {
    "julix": 57,
    "lamys": 992,
    "kasvan": 209,
    "quenok": 750,
    "alddor": 259,
    "oliath": 1009,
    "wenix": 815,
}

## Environment Variables: Pagination

Hey, welcome to the Fernstack API team! Our public REST API paginates everything with cursor tokens. Two knobs matter: PAGE_DEFAULT_SIZE (we use 25) and PAGE_MAX_SIZE (hard cap, 200 — please don't raise it without asking Priya's team). Cursors are opaque to clients but they're actually encrypted offsets, which means the API needs a signing secret to mint and verify them. That secret lives in the env file, set by the line right below this one.

vault entry, yahif-yajep: COURIER_KEY29=b802bdf8034096b65a51c6ba5abe2